Class TriggerHandler

java.lang.Object
com.sucy.skill.dynamic.TriggerHandler
All Implemented Interfaces:
org.bukkit.event.Listener

public class TriggerHandler extends Object implements org.bukkit.event.Listener
ProSkillAPI © 2023 com.sucy.skill.dynamic.TriggerHandler
  • Constructor Details

  • Method Details

    • getKey

      public String getKey()
    • getTrigger

      public Trigger getTrigger()
    • getComponent

      public EffectComponent getComponent()
    • init

      public void init(org.bukkit.entity.LivingEntity entity, int level)
    • cleanup

      public void cleanup(org.bukkit.entity.LivingEntity entity)
    • register

      public void register(SkillAPI plugin)
      Registers needed events for the skill, ignoring any unused events for efficiency
      Parameters:
      plugin - plugin reference